An indie developer is currently working on an impressive RPG that is heavily inspired by Square Enix's "Final Fantasy XV" and Capcom's "Devil May Cry."
The RPG is called "Lost Soul Aside," and as this gameplay video shows, it gets a lot of cues from big name RPG "Final Fantasy XV," as well as sleek moves similar to Dante in "Devil May Cry."
Amazingly enough, the game is being developed single-handedly by a Korean game designer named Bing Yang.
According to Only SP, the game has been in development for over two years, and the creator himself said that the game takes a lot of elements from the upcoming Square Enix title.
Yang is a self-confessed "Final Fantasy XV" fan and said that he has been waiting for the title ever since it was first announced. He also said that he is a huge fan of the series.
"I saw many guys compare my game with FFXV," Yang said on his Twitter account. "I have to say that FFXV is far beyond it."
The developer is also looking to make changes to the designs to make the game more unique. He has also paid a professional voice actor to do all the voices in the trailer.
Yang also said that the game is in its prototype stage, and is "far from complete." Yang also pointed out that he still does not have any platforms in mind for the game.
"I'll try to finish it but I can't promise," he said on Twitter, also saying that he does not want to go through crowdfunding and ask people for money before making sure that he can finish the project.
Despite the game being only on its early stages, the trailer and screenshots of the game already show so much potential.
